Jones's Roundleaf Bat vs saltillo juniper
Hipposideros jonesi compared with Juniperus saltillensis
Key Differences
- Jones's Roundleaf Bat is Near Threatened while saltillo juniper is Endangered.
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Jones's Roundleaf Bat | saltillo juniper |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om | Animalia (Animals) | Plantae (Plants) |
| Phylum | Chordata (Chordates) | Coniferophyta (Conifers) |
| Class | Mammalia (Mammals) | Pinopsida (Conifers) |
| Order | Chiroptera (Bats) | Pinales (Pines & Allies) |
| Family | Hipposideridae | Cupressaceae |
| Genus | Hipposideros | Juniperus |
| Species | Hipposideros jonesi | Juniperus saltillensis |
